Description:
A vulnerability was reported in IBM AIX. A local user can obtain elevated privileges on the target system.
A local user can exploit a flaw in the getpwnam() function to gain elevated privileges.
Systems configured with customer extended LDAP user filtering are affected.
|
Impact:
A local user can obtain elevated privileges on the target system.
|
Solution:
The vendor has issued a fix.
5.3.12: APAR IV18638
6.1.5: APAR IV19097
6.1.6: APAR IV19077
6.1.7: APAR IV18637
7.1.0: APAR IV19098
7.1.1: APAR IV18464
